Moog Spectravox Semi-Modular Analog Spectral Processor Now Available

Moog Music has introduced the Spectravox Semi-Modular Analog Spectral Processor, an all-in-one synth voice and vocoder and the company’s fourth device in the Mother-32 Eurorack format. … Read More Moog Spectravox Semi-Modular Analog Spectral Processor Now Available

Something To Think About

I’m always in one of three modes. I’m in “Let’s try an experiment” mode, which is quite undirected.

The next stage is a flow state where I’m just fiddling with things. I’m in a mood of some kind. I can be in that stage for hours, and I only notice when I have to pee.

The third stage, which I probably spend a lot more time in than most other artists, is a questioning stage: “OK, I’ve made that thing. What does it mean? Why did it interest me?”

— Brian Eno
